The Bet Types: Covering Small and Big to Specific Triples

To play Sic Bo with confidence, you should know the key betting groups. The two most popular wagers are Small and Big. Small pays when the total of the three dice falls between 4 and 10, excluding triples. Big includes totals from 11 to 17, also excluding triples, resulting in both bets losing. These provide nearly a 50% win chance and typically pay even money. Beyond these, the table splits into riskier wagers with higher rewards. We commonly recommend starting with Small or Big while they grasp the pace. Below we explain the additional key bets you’ll see at Winzter Casino’s Sic Bo tables.

  • Odd and Even Bets: Comparable to Small and Big, these wagers cover whether the sum of the dice is an odd or even number, excluding triples. Payout is 1:1.
  • Sum Bets: You bet on the exact sum of the three dice, from 4 to 17. Payouts vary widely; a total of 9 or 12 can pay 6:1, while a rare 4 or 17 pays 50:1 or more.
  • Single Dice Bet: You choose one number (1–6) and succeed if that number shows on one, two, or all three dice. Payouts increase accordingly: one match pays 1:1, two matches pay 2:1, and three matches pay 3:1.
  • Pair of Dice Bet: You place a bet on two specific numbers landing on at least two of the dice, e.g., 3 and 5. Payout is typically 6:1.
  • Specific Double: You bet that two of the dice will show a particular number, say two 4s. Payouts usually vary from 8:1 to 11:1.
  • Triple Any Number: Wins if all three dice display an identical number, any number. Payouts are around 30:1.
  • Specific Triple: The highest-risk bet; you predict the specific triple, such as three 6s. The payout is typically 150:1 or sometimes 180:1 based on the table.

Each bet type comes with its own house margin, which we’ll explore shortly. Sic Bo game Payments and the House Advantage

Sic Bo payouts straight mirror how rare a roll is to take place. A Specific Triple, such as all dice displaying 3, has a chance of just 1 in 216, so the payment of 150:1 still leaves the house with a sizable edge. Small and Big bets succeed 48.61% of the time, but because they lose on any triple, that edge appears. We find it instructive to examine the theoretical return-to-player (RTP) rates for each bet. While exact RTP varies by paytable, typically Small/Big and Odd/Even deliver around 97.22%, while a Total bet on 9 or 12 might sit near 90%, and a Specific Triple can fall below 80%. This is why we encourage regular players to stick to even-money wagers when trying Sic Bo at Winzter Casino. By learning these payout terms, you can match your budget with a appropriate risk level.

Many live dealer Sic Bo games at Winzter Casino present the paytable visibly, and some even show a log of past rolls, which some players employ for pattern betting. We caution you, though, that each roll is unrelated, and past results do not affect future outcomes. The words “hot” and “cold” numbers are not mechanical truths; they are psychological patterns. The real power is in grasping the payout ratio displayed next to each selection. When you see “30:1” next to “Any Triple,” you can intellectually consider that against the 2.8% likelihood to decide if the risk fits your session. By founding your decisions in these numbers rather than myth, you turn Sic Bo into a game of thoughtful chance, not assumption.

How would you describe the difference between “Big” and “Small” bets in Sic Bo?

Big and Small are the most straightforward wagers. A Small bet wins when the sum of the three dice is between 4 and 10, provided the dice do not form a triple. A Big bet wins on totals from 11 to 17, again excluding triples. If a triple occurs, both bets lose immediately. These bets pay 1:1 and have a house edge of around 2.78%, making them the best entry point for new players at Winzter Casino.

How do Specific Triple bets work and why are the payouts so high?

A Specific Triple means you are betting that all three dice will land on one precise number, such as three 4s. Because there are 216 possible outcomes with three dice, the probability of rolling a named triple is just 1 in 216. Payouts range from 150:1 to 180:1, which sounds generous but still carries a significant house edge. This bet is purely for fun value; we recommend allocating only a tiny part of your bankroll to such long shots.
